Christmas has come early for Virgin Atlantic Flying Club members.

From today, Virgin is discounting the number of Virgin Points required for all award seats to and from the United States and the Caribbean by 50% for travel from Oct. 28, 2022, through March 25, 2023.

While discounts on award redemptions are offered from time to time across different programs, such as Flying Blue's monthly promo deals, these offers are usually full of frustrating restrictions, like blackout dates or they may only be valid for economy class flights or a handful of routes.

This offer is far more generous and straightforward. Simply redeem your Virgin Points from Oct. 28, through Nov. 7, 2022, for a flight operated by Virgin Atlantic to any destination they fly in the U.S. or the Caribbean from now through March 25, 2023, on any date in any cabin, and you will receive 50% of your Virgin Points back after you travel.

Cash fares, upgraded with Virgin Points will also receive 50% of the Points back. As you might imagine, unfortunately, there is no discount on the fees, taxes and surcharges payable on redemptions.

Gold Reward Seats (reward seats booked with double points) are excluded. However, Upgrade Rewards and Companion Rewards, including those earned on Virgin Atlantic credit cards, are eligible for this offer.​ Flights operated by partner airlines like Air France, KLM and Delta are also excluded.

Related: Leisurely luxury: A review of Virgin Atlantic's A350 leisure configuration in Upper Class from Manchester to Orlando

With no blackout dates and all cabins applicable, this is likely to be the best points and miles redemption deal you will see this year. Given the majority of Virgin's route network is from the U.K. to the U.S. and Caribbean, the only destinations excluded from this offer are:

  • Cape Town.
  • Delhi, India.
  • Islamabad.
  • Johannesburg.
  • Lahore, Pakistan.
  • Mumbai, India.
  • Tel Aviv.

So how many Virgin Points can you save on your next redemption?

Here are the normal prices for round-trip redemptions on Virgin Atlantic, with the 50% discount prices also displayed. For one-way you will need half of the discounted price, with flights starting from a very low 5,000 each way to the northeast U.S.

Remember, Virgin's brand new A330neo aircraft with a new Upper-Class Suite is now flying to Boston (BOS), and soon to Tampa (TPA), with both destinations included in this offer.

VIRGIN ATLANTIC


Flying 23,750 miles from Florida to the U.K. each way in business class is one of the best redemption deals you are likely to see for the foreseeable future, even with taxes and fuel surcharges.

Here are the standard travel dates for the offer period:

  • Nov. 2 through Dec. 9, 2022.
  • Jan. 5 through March 23, 2023.

Caribbean standard season dates:

  • Nov. 2 through Dec. 9, 2022.
  • Jan. 1 through March 5, 2023.
  • March 30 through April 18, 2023.

Here are the peak dates for the offer period:

  • Oct. 28 through Nov. 1, 2022.
  • Dec.10-31, 2022.
  • Jan. 1-4, 2023.
  • March 24-25, 2023.

Caribbean peak season dates:

  • Oct. 28 through Nov. 1, 2022.
  • Dec. 10-31, 2022.
  • Jan. 1 through March 5, 2023.

The offer process is a little unusual and convoluted. Rather than discounting the points needed when booking during the offer period, Flying Club members will need to redeem the full amount, and will then receive 50% of their points back after traveling into their Virgin Red accounts, 28 days after travel.

Flying Club members must make sure they have opened a Virgin Red account before they travel so they can receive the points back. Your Virgin Points will display in both your Flying Club and Virgin Red accounts, meaning you can use the refunded points in your Virgin Red account to book flights through Flying Club without having to transfer them from account to account.

Still, for such a generous offer it is worth jumping through a few small hoops and I suspect this promotion has been launched to encourage Flying Club members to open Virgin Red accounts. If you have an existing redemption to an eligible destination during the offer period, you may wish to cancel it for $50 (£43) and rebook from Oct, 28, so the booking benefits from the 50% points refund discount.
